The National Geospatial-Intelligence Agency (NGA) intends to award a sole source contract to California Institute of Technology, The Infrared Processing and Analysis Center (IPAC), 1200 E California Blvd, Pasadena CA 91125 to develop software for infrared data. This effort includes the development and delivery of software for space-based infrared sensors for improved resolution. The technique to be developed will have functional characteristics such that it accurately report the position and photometry of point sources in the field of view, and accurately reconstruct underlying backgrounds without introducing artifacts into the background data. The physical characteristics of the data to be operated on will include noise and artifacts consistent with those produced by infrared detector arrays.
